将float转换为int可以使用以下几种方法: 强制类型转换:可以通过将float类型的变量直接赋值给int类型的变量来进行转换,但是该方法会将小数部分舍弃,只保留整数部分。例如: 代码语言:txt 复制 float_num = 3.14 int_num = int(float_num) 推荐的腾讯云相关产品:腾讯云函数(SCF,Serverless Cloud Function)是一个事件驱...
let floatNum = 3.14; let intNum = Math.floor(floatNum); // 结果为3 这种方法是将float转为int的简单且直接的方式,尤其是在处理金融、计算分页等场景时非常实用。 二、MATH.CEIL() 方法 Math.ceil()函数执行向上取整操作,无论浮点数的小数部分是多少,都会使整数部分加一(除非原数已经是整数)。 使用场景...
cc = int("-123.45") print(f"{cc=}") # 输出 ValueError: invalid literal for int() with base 10: '-123.45' dd = int("34a") print(f"{dd=}") # 输出 ValueError: invalid literal for int() with base 10: '34a' ee = int("12.3") print(f"{ee=}") # 输出 ValueError: invalid ...
int 转成 float的过程,即为上面过程的逆过程。 需要注意的是,上面方法只对 f < 2^23 时可用,因为我们指数对齐是向2^23 对其的。 2、float 与 int 互相转换(负数) 对于负数的转换,我们需要使用 bias =1.5×223,也就是下面的代码,然后执行上面的转换就行了。 bias.i = ((23 + 127) << 23) + (1...
Float转换为Int的方式 在Java中,有几种方法可以将float转换为int。下面是一些常见的方法: 强制类型转换(Casting) 使用Math.round()方法 使用Math.floor()或Math.ceil()方法 1. 强制类型转换 强制类型转换是最直接的方法。此方法将丢弃小数部分,仅保留整数部分。这是一种快速且高效的转换方式。
在C语言中,可以使用强制类型转换来将float类型转换为int类型,或将int类型转换为float类型。 将float转换为int: float floatNum = 3.14; int intNum = (int)floatNum; 复制代码 将int转换为float: int intNum = 10; float floatNum = (float)intNum; 复制代码 需要注意的是在进行由float到int的转换时,小数...
Java中将float转换为int的方法有两种:1. 使用强制类型转换:可以使用强制类型转换操作符将float类型的值转换为int类型的值。例如:```javafloat f = 3.14f;int ...
在Python中,我们可以通过使用int()函数将一个float类型的数据强制转换为int类型。在进行这种转换时,需要遵守一些规则。 •如果我们想要将一个正数的浮点数转换为整数类型,那么强制转换会取该浮点数的整数部分。例如,int(3.14)会得到结果3。 •如果我们想要将一个负数的浮点数转换为整数类型,那么强制转换会将该浮点...
将一列float数据转成int的步骤如下:1. 使用float()函数将数据转换为浮点数。例如,将整数15转换为浮点数:代码示例:float(15) => 15.0 2. 将转换后的浮点数使用int()函数转换为整数。例如,将15.0转换为整数:代码示例:int(15.0) => 15 3. 对于字符串类型的浮点数,使用float()函数转换...